Role Overview: Design Manager

The Design Manager is responsible for leading a team of Interior Designers and Draftsmen while ensuring design excellence, adherence to Bonito's design language, and seamless cross-functional coordination. This role blends creative leadership, client engagement, and project ownership, ensuring designs are delivered on time, within scope, and to the highest quality standards.

Key Responsibilities

Design & Project Ownership

  • Lead and manage end-to-end design delivery across multiple projects
  • Define design strategy and planning at project kick-off
  • Ensure consistency with Bonito's design philosophy and quality benchmarks
  • Review and approve all design outputs before client presentations
  • Oversee 2D drawings, 3D designs, estimates, and BOQs
  • Conduct design reviews at site and ensure execution alignment

Client Management

  • Participate in key client meetings and design presentations
  • Guide designers to effectively close designs with clients
  • Handle complex design discussions, revisions, and escalations
  • Ensure a high level of customer satisfaction throughout the design lifecycle

Team Leadership & Development

  • Lead, mentor, and coach Interior Designers, Draftsmen, and new joinees
  • Evaluate team performance and provide continuous feedback
  • Train and onboard new Designers and CRM/design team members
  • Foster collaboration, accountability, and a high-performance culture

Cross-Functional Coordination

  • Collaborate closely with Sales, CRM, Execution, and Estimation teams
  • Manage design timelines and ensure alignment with project schedules
  • Proactively identify risks and resolve design or coordination issues

Innovation & Continuous Improvement

  • Create and review design concepts and layouts
  • Stay updated with market trends, materials, and best practices
  • Drive design innovation while maintaining feasibility and cost efficiency

Ideal Candidate Profile

Experience & Education

  • Minimum 8 years of relevant experience in Interior Design / ArchitectureDegree/Diploma in Interior Design or Architecture
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D, SketchUp, rendering software
  • Working knowledge of Adobe Photoshop & MS Office
  • Strong understanding of construction detailing and execution feasibility
